Transaction 629263897b4a15159a81431d3279baed21e920d625240212508eacd01f4edc77
1 Input
1 Output
-
629263897b4a15159a81431d3279baed21e920d625240212508eacd01f4edc77:0
- value
- 4997853
- script pubkey
- OP_0 OP_PUSHBYTES_20 c8ec0f8aba5e8b1d032f89dda5e881fb8a1fc068
- address
- bc1qerkqlz46t6936qe038w6t6yplw9plsrggxgsxr